Diffusion-weighted MRI (DWI) and perfusion-weighted MRI (PWI) show promise for acute stroke therapy selection. However, DWI correlates better with positron emission tomography (PET) for predicting infarct volume than PWI, which is less reliable for identifying penumbra.
